网站开发实习日记
日记顾名思义就是一日一记。以下就是小编整理的网站开发实习日记范文,一起来看看吧!
网站开发实习日记
1
今天是参加实习的第一天,今天的任务比较轻松,算是步入职场的第一部。在简单地与项目经历交流后,我们很快地就做好了入职手续。我们的项目经理是一个很好的人,待我们很和蔼,,总保持有微笑,很好交流,给我们留下了很好的印象。相信在将来的一段时间里的工作开展和实习任务的实施,我们会与项目经理做好密切的配合,共创一片辉煌。 在接下来的时间里,项目经理非常有耐心地向我们讲解了企业文化和部门特色,以及相关的部门规定,这让我们在公司的良好运营打下了结实的基础。为什么这么说呢?公司规章制度是为进一步深化企业管理,充分调动发挥公司员工的积极性和创造性,切实维护公司利益和保障员工的合法权益,规范公司全体员工的行为和职业道德。结合《公司法》和《劳动法》等相关规定,建立的一套管理制度,以促使公司从经验管理型模式向科学管理的模式转变。
那么接下来的时间里面,我们就被领到了各自的位置上,那么从坐下来的那一刻起,我们就正式开始了实习的生活。工作就是工作,必须一丝不苟。今天的任务其实很简单的,我们的项目经理就安排我们手洗一下环境。在这么轻松愉快的办公环境下,我们很快地适应了环境。迅速地打开电脑开始了工作。用eclipse从svn上checkout了部门现在正在进行的项目代码。带着一片好奇心和渴望工作渴望证明自己的决心,我紧张兮兮地阅读着代码。不知不觉地,今天就下班了。
2
今天来公司的时候我特别早,希望新的一天早一点能给自己一些新的期望和一些新的动力。作为IT公司的一名员工,不能像一些机关单位那样死气沉沉,这样做不成什么事情。有了这样的觉悟后,在面临工作的挑战我们也能更从容不迫地去面对。
今天部门的老大让我跟着一名老员工做。其实说是跟着老员工做,其实主要还是让我去学习,毕竟说白了我还是刚离开校园的学生,各方面工作能力和操作水平远远没有达到企业员工工作高度的水平,因此我的工作实际上就变得相当轻松了。我的任务很简单,就是接触学习熟悉上手。
我要接手的内容是web service。在这一块的内容上,其实我的基础是薄弱的。因为之前在校的学习简短我也只是注重JAVA的学习,浅薄地学习了些struts,hibernate,spring这三大框架的内容,并没有在其他领域有所突破。好在老员工待我不薄,他很人性化地站在我的角度上替我考虑, 也了解我作为一名新人的羞涩和困惑,遇到困难他也能及时地给与我帮助和鼓励。这点让我十分感动,在严谨作风的公司里有了一丝丝小家庭的温暖。
附:Web Service平台是用XSD来作为数据类型系统的。当你用某种语言如VB. NET或C# 来构造一个Web Service时,为了符合Web Service标准,所有你使用的数据类型都必须被转换为XSD类型。如想让它使用在不同平台和不同软件的不同组织间传递,还需要用某种东西将它包装起来。这种东西就是一种协议,如 SOAP。
3
今天是上岗的第三天。前两天给我的感觉还是相对轻松的,没有死命盯着屏幕敲着代码。
无论是做开发还是看文档,都让我们觉得挺轻松的,还没有真正切切地感受到作为程序员的压力。但是无论是程序员也好,做管理也好,其实在上海每天遇到的压力都是很大的。大家每天都在为梦想为了前途去奔波,总是希望自己能过的更好,总喜欢自己能在上海闯出一片天地闯出一片名堂来。作为我们学校的大四学生,我们身上的跳着的担子还是有的,我们要考自己的双收去打造一片海阔天空,收复一片绿水蓝天。那么正确的人生姿态是很重要的,这将领导我们正确地走向人生道理。因此如何去对待实习,其实也就是反映出了对待人生的态度,我们没有退路,必须一丝不苟。
我的同事他们一开始就要看文档看需求分析。那么我们在实习开发过程中要怎么看待需求分析呢?在软件工程中,需求分析指的是在建立一个新的或改变一个现存的电脑系统时描写新系统的目的、范围、定义和功能时所要做的所有的工作。需求分析是软件工程中的一个关键过程。在这个过程中,系统分析员和软件工程师确定顾客的需要。只有在确定了这些需要后他们才能够分析和寻求新系统的解决方法。
无论是需求分析还是web service,其实这些天我们在公司实习还是相当有意义的,每天都有新收获。
4
今天是我们实习生进入实习的第四天,作为一名软件开发人员,其实我们更注重的还是一些类似于开发的东西,那么在这个实习 的过程里,我们就要更多地花一些时间在研究代码和接触项目以及业务,这对于我们更好地理解我们的职业需求和职业规划,有着不可分割的关系。那么如何去定义我们的职业生涯以及策划我们的职业走向,其实是我们程序员在人生道路上的一个很重要的抉择点,是否能健全地把程序员这条道路走下去,走踏实了,是我们在漫漫人生路上面临的一个重大的挑战。
我简单地认为有以下几点矛盾存在在我们日常生活和工作中:
其一:这是一个适合与不适合的问题,有的人他有干 IT 行业的天赋,他就会干的得心应手,不论多大年龄都不成问题。国外胡子一大把还干着开发的老外多了去,他们的思维同样活跃,精力充沛,并且还有大量的经验和积累。
其二:对于那些并不喜欢 IT 行业的人,不小心选择了这个职业,他目前在 IT 行业苦苦挣扎,学技术进度相应就会比前者进度慢,又一时找不到更好的职业,技术平平,为了完成任务不得已天天加班。
其三:关于转行的观点中也有两个集中点:行业自身与年龄问题。技术的日新月异,各个公司的血液不断换新,企业想要发展依赖于产品,而产品的开发归于技术的支持。新老开发人员的不同在于,老一辈的开发人员在年轻时学的技术在现在应用的很少了,生活上上有老下有小,体力和精力投入的要少,学习新技术的能力比不上年轻人,思路也不灵敏了,逻辑分析能力,理解能力逐步减退,唯剩经验,但是 IT 届的经验不如创新值钱。
其四:现在网上到处都有很多开源的代码下载 ,对于那些热衷于开发的人来说 ,随着工作时间的变长,发现当初怀着对技术的崇敬,加入其中,原本以为这是个崇尚技术本身的队伍,但慢慢发现很多技术管理,技术经理他们的技术并非想象中的那么好,依靠着资历换得职位,技术为上的梦想也逐步幻灭。
今天是我上班的第五天了,挺开心的,今天到了周五。到了一周工作日的末端,其实大家心思都不在公司了,早在那九霄云外潇洒去了。但是即便如此,作为一名职业素养到位的IT人士,秉持着对工作对项目负责的态度,不能因为个人生活上因为追求享受而就把现实放在了一旁,大家还是真心实意地想把工作做好,把项目进度赶上,早日让项目上线。 在大方向不乱的前景下,我们翘首以盼期待着下班时刻的到来的同时,安分守己地在自己的岗位上兢兢业业,丝毫不敢怠慢。总的来说,到公司实习也有一周了,在这一周里,不管是做开发也好还是做测试也好,大家各司其职,努力干活。在老大的指示下,我们有条不紊地展开着工作和学习。我们的SOA平台80%已经完成,这个基于struts,hibernate,spring框架的项目,逐渐也浮上台面。
由于我们要做到是web service,所以接下来的任务我们除了要把平台搭建完善,就要把工作重要放在SOA上了。这对我们是个挑战。这意味着我们需要面对全新的领域做开发了。老大的工作安排也下来了,就是要求我们采用中软国际的开发产品R1做开发。R1是一个基于eclipse的IDE。多年来,中软国际精准把握客户需求,凭借自主研发的应用整合和业务支撑中间件产品ResourceOne,帮助用户实现信息化工程建设全生命周期的最佳操控,并一向致力于实现企业级信息系统的业务应用创建支撑、集成、管理、运维服务及业务优化,并在制造业(烟草工业及整个行业)、零售业(烟草销售)、电子政务工程(多个国家金字号工程、政府机关、经济技术开发区)中都已有广泛的应用和大量成功案例。
我们的工作目标就很明确了,采用R1作为开发工具,利用该IDE做一些开发。具体怎么样,还要等到下周一后才知道。
6
很快的,一个周末就这样过去了,再这样的一个工作环境里,其实周末对我们来说并不能算是周末,因为大家出门在外,不像在家里那般有这自由的活动空间,因此对于每个人来说如何合理地利用在外实习以及出门再外身心自由的大好情况,是考研我们如何正确地去对待我们的人生。如果你认真地对自己的时间负责,那么时间也会对你的人生负责。其实说白了就是我们需要好好地利用这个周末,去做一些有利于自己发展的事情,长这么大了不能老是只记得玩,在玩的同时更注重地是看待自己的发展,对自己的未来打下一片良好的基础。因此在这么一个大前提下,上周末我们实习生其实并没有在周末去哪里各种潇洒,反而我们利用在周末时间跑到公司加班,学习专业知识,补充自己专业能力,弥补一些能力空白,为更好地适应岗位打下结实的基础。
今天老大来了就给我们布置了任务,我们的任务就像上周说的那样采用R1进行开发。R1是中软国际的产品,也是我们母公司自主研发的高度集成的IDE开发环境,能够快速有效地进行SOA的封装,为我们解决快速开发以及一些冗余的工作内容的节省,起了重大的作用。比如一些办公室的OA开发,我们完全可以抛开原来传统的开发形势,已用中软国际的IDE——R1,迅速地搭建OA办公,实现无纸化办公系统。因此学习R1的使用,是我们近期的重点工作。
今天我们的任务还是R1。R1是高度集成的开发环境,因此我们在掌握R1的使用,就波费苦心了。今天的内容是部署R1 DE-I环境、产品的发布包结构和完成安装后生 成的文件目录结构,并针对多种主流企业级中间件产品(数据库、应用服务器 等)分别详细描述了产品安装方法、数据库创建步骤以及资源配置等内容。可 按照如下步骤安装部署R1 DE-I交换网络:
1、准备数据库环境(创建数据库、执行初始化脚本)2.4
2、在应用服务器中搭建运行环境:
1)部署R1 DE-I管理控制台2.5
2)部署 R1 DE-I服务器2.5
3)部署 R1 DE-I管理代理服务器2.
在部署的过程还是比较痛苦的,因为没有早期的开发经验,因此我们类似于一穷二白地摸黑探索,在这个过程还是相当不轻松的。当当是配置的过程就颇让我们煞费苦心的,甚至我们早早地就泄气了,丧失了战斗力,工作情绪几句下降。在这个时候,技术总监站了出来,他抛下了繁忙的工作,不辞辛劳地为我们排忧解难,共同吃苦共同患难,在搞鼓了大半个下午,R1也算是成功地让我们部署到了服务器。望着技术总监满脸辛勤的汗水,我们真心地感受到了集体的温暖,我们有理由相信在这么和蔼可亲、平易近人的技术总监带领下,我们可以共同创造出一番大事情来。今天的工作虽然结束了,但是我们的心却是更加紧密地结合在了一起,相信明天会更精彩!
8
今天又是新的一天。今天的.我们拼着一股干劲,不辞辛劳地一大早就赶来了公司,开始了新的一天工作。我们有信心,围绕在技术总监的周围,把R1的技术方案搞好。我们也有信心,有点及面,从我们这里做试点,把R1技术推广到全公司,让所有员工获利。每每想到此,我们就干劲十足,牺牲小我,成全大我。我们付出的每一滴汗水不是白流的,我们有理由相信,公司的蒸蒸日上离不开我们的辛勤劳作,在推进公司更上一台阶的大规划中,我们贡献出了微薄的力量。
今天的内容还是继续昨天的工作,但是在开始工作前,我们需要学习一些R1的知识。 消息 :是按一定规范封装的数据包,应用与R1 DE-I 总线的数据交换是通过消息来 传递的。
路由 :在数据交换过程中寻找消息目的地(一般为一个R1DE-I 服务器或者相应连 接器及服务等)的过程叫路由。
路由表 :多个R1 DE-I 服务器按照一定拓扑关系组成一棵树型结构,树中每个 R1 DE-I 服务器都有自己的唯一标识,并且与上下级交换服务器存在逻辑结构上的父子关系(但事实上相连的R1 DE-I 服务器间关系对等,不存在上下级关系),形 成了R1 DE-I 总线的拓扑结构;R1 DE-I 服务器间的这种关系构成了一份路由表, 是消息在R1 DE-I 服务器间传输路径的依据。一个R1 DE-I 总线有且只有一份路由表。
? R1 DE-I 管理代理模块 :R1DE-I 采用基于R1MC 规范的分布式管理框架,要求每个被管理的R1DE-I 服务器所在的物理主机上必须部署相应的R1DE-I 管理代理模块,该模块插入在管理代理容器中运行,提供来自管理控制台的的管理请求代理功能。 R1 DE-I 交换总线 :提供了应用集成的连接中枢,可以消除不同应用之间的技术差异,让不同 的应用协调运作,实现了不同服务之间的通信与整合。
消息流 :消息流是在R1DE-I 设计工具中设计,以消息流ID 号和版本号作为唯一标 识,它描述了消息在R1 DE-I 服务器中有序的、有步骤的处理过程。
消息映射 :不同消息格式之间的转换规则,用户通过设计消息映射,使不同格式的消息 能够互相转换。
学习完了R1的相关知识,我们对R1的开发有了更具体的了解,对R1的使用又有了新的体会。
9
今天的R1开发遇到了困难,我们在一些技术环节上出现了棘手的麻烦,这个麻烦不是一时我们能够解决的。于是我们请求了R1的开发小组的技术支持,寻求中软国际的帮助。具体的问题如下:
应用场景:
现在我们的需求是将两个服务封装成一个服务。具体场景如下:存在两个服务:一个是根据身份证号查询卡信息,另一个是根据卡号查询黑名单信息。我们要做的是将这两个服务封装成一个代理服务,即用户只需要输入身份证号即可查询到黑名单信息。即用户通过代理服务先调用服务1再调用服务2。遇到的问题是当调用完服务1得到的是一个Pcard型的对象,取出其中的cardid再调用服务2.这中间的参数该怎么映射呢???
我的封装步骤为:
1. 导入两个服务的wsdl
文件,
2. 根据wsdl文件定义两个消息格式
Pcard Blist
【网站开发实习日记】相关文章:
网站开发实习自我鉴定参考12-18
网站开发实习自我鉴定5篇12-17
网站开发网站维护简历范文10-15
网站维护及开发简历范文10-12
网站开发/网站维护个人简历表格11-13
网站开发网站维护人员简历范文11-02
电子商务网站开发网站维护简历10-28
网站开发员英语简历范文10-10
网站开发毕业论文大纲08-14
网站实习心得12-04